Some good questions have been asked about the contest, so I thought I would share those and the answers here.
1) In the stat block, Fort. and Ref. are followed by a . but Will is not. Is that intentional, or should Will also be followed by a .?
Fort. and Ref. are abbreviations, Will is not.
2) Most Entries have : after then (such as HD, hp, and Init) while a couple do not (such as SA, SQ, and AL). Is this intentional or should they too be followed by a :?
Sorry, that's my mistake. Do not put ":" after any of the entries, only after the initial block of name, race, and class info.
3) Whats the format for presenting the specifics of the SA and SQ?
If the SA or SQ is described in the MM, do not bother putting extended explanations. If they differ in any way (such as altered save DCs) or are not described in the MM, then put them beneath skills and feats.
4) How hard is the 10,000 word limit?
Its flexible, but not by much.
5) Should the OGL entry be considered when determining the 10,000 word limit? I am assuming as author its my responsibility to annotate which material I got my OG material from, correct?
The word count limit does not include the OGL. In fact, you don't need to include the OGL with your entry, but please send all copyright info for any OGC you use so I can update the Section 15 on the winner(s).
